In a nutshell: Apple has allowed the primary PC emulator on the App Retailer simply weeks after taking pictures it and an identical app down in a transfer that confused builders. UTM SE is a retro PC emulator able to emulating x86, PPC, and RISC-V architectures (in 32-bit and 64-bit variants) to run basic software program, and helps each VGA mode for graphics and terminal mode for text-only working programs.
In response to the App Retailer itemizing, customers can run pre-built machines or create customized configurations from scratch. It’s obtainable now without spending a dime for iPhone, iPad, and Imaginative and prescient Professional.
Whereas a win for emulation, UTM SE is not precisely what the app’s developer had in thoughts. Ideally, the emulator would make the most of just-in-time (JIT) compilation to compile code as a program is working. Apple, nonetheless, sees this as a safety danger and doe not permit it.
To get round this, the group got here up with a threaded interpreter that will get the job completed however is slower than JIT. As such, the “SE” in UTM SE stands for “gradual version.”
We’re comfortable to announce that UTM SE is offered (without spending a dime) on iOS and visionOS App Retailer (and coming quickly to AltStore PAL)!
Shoutouts to AltStore group for his or her assist and to Apple for reconsidering their coverage.https://t.co/HAV5JnT5GO
– UTM (@UTMapp) July 13, 2024
OMG Ubuntu notes that for “historic” working programs, the JIT bottleneck will not be as a lot of a problem as these platforms have been constructed for slower {hardware}. Newer working programs which might be extra useful resource intensive are going to current extra of a problem.
The devs have some helpful guides obtainable to assist customers stand up and working on their most popular OS, however you’ll need to supply your personal set up ISO for Home windows.
Apple solely not too long ago warmed as much as the thought of permitting retro sport emulators within the App Retailer. Prior, the one method to run such software program on Apple cellular {hardware} was to sideload it on a jailbroken system.
One of many first apps to reap the benefits of the chance was Nintendo emulator Delta, and shortly grew to become the highest free app. Even now, roughly three months later, it sits at quantity 35 on the leisure charts. UTM SE, in the meantime, is at quantity 22 on the identical leisure chart.